Subject: Quickstore 4.2 — bloom filter now fronts the KV layer

Plugin authors: starting with this release, Quickstore places a bloom filter ahead of the key-value store. Negative lookups return faster; false positives fall through safely. No API changes are required on your side. Verify your plugin against the staging build referenced below.

session token of fahif-tadup = htk3_9c7

### Release Checklist — Stridegate Chip Reader v4.2

Support team: before sign-off, verify the Stridegate reader firmware pairs with mats running the previous two releases, confirm split times sync within five seconds of a finish-line read, and run the cold-start recovery drill. Known issue: duplicate reads on tightly packed starts are mitigated but not eliminated. The firmware build for this release is identified below.

session token of tajef-bageg = htk21_5d90d574934f3ccae6437

### Action Item 7: Harden pagination defaults

During the Brindlewood API incident, clients requesting unbounded page sizes exhausted the read replicas. Owner: the platform pod. We will enforce server-side caps on page size and cursor lifetime, returning a 400 rather than silently truncating. Document the limits in the public reference. The agreed tuning constants, pending review at next sync, are:

tuning table, bagep-tahof:
RATE_LIMITS = {
    "ralael": 10,
    "druath": 5,
}

## Deployment

FormulaForge evaluates user-supplied formulas inside the Quillbox sandbox, and the release manager must confirm the sandbox image digest before every rollout. The evaluator runs with no network access, a 250 ms CPU budget, and a frozen standard library; any drift in these limits must be flagged to the Harrowgate platform team. Verify that the sandbox pool warms up before traffic shifts, since cold evaluators can stall checkout flows. The production settings the deploy job reads are listed below.

deployment values, kajep-kageg:
[praix]
host = praix.paliqcorp.corp
user = praix_svc
database = praix_prod

- [ ] Roof terrace check: The terrace door on Level 5 at Brindlewood House tends to jam in damp weather. Push firmly at the top-right corner while turning the handle — don't force the lower latch, as Facilities at Corvane Ltd have logged it for repair. The door must never be propped open. If you need terrace access on your first day for the welcome lunch, use the pass below.

staff pass of kawip-hawef = bdg-QLP-2